Title: A Two-Sample Test for Equality of Means in High Dimension
Author(s): Karl Gregory*+ and Soumen Lahiri
Companies: Texas A&M University and Texas A&M University
Address: 401 Anderson Street, College Station, TX, 77840-3293, United States
Keywords: high dimension ; two sample
Abstract:

A new test statistic is developed for testing equality of mean vectors from two independent samples in the high-dimensional two-population setting. Given the breakdown of classical multivariate methods like Hotelling's T^2 test when the number of variables measured on each subject exceeds the sample size, and given the accelerating proliferation of such data, inferential methods that are stable in this setting are desired. The test herein developed is valid in the "large p, small n" setting, does not assume normality, and allows for a long-range dependence structure among the random vector components.
